Local Expertise in Waterloo
Working daily in Waterloo means we understand the realities of moving in this area: tight streets, red routes, bus lanes and controlled parking. We regularly serve properties around the South Bank, The Cut, Lower Marsh, Blackfriars Road and the wider SE1 area.
We know how to plan around:
- Loading restrictions and bay suspensions
- Lift access in blocks and office buildings
- Time-limited loading areas near stations and theatres
That local knowledge helps us keep moves smooth, punctual and well coordinated.

Items We Exclude
For safety, legal and insurance reasons, we cannot move:
- Hazardous materials (fuel, gas bottles, chemicals, paint thinners)
- Illegal items or anything that breaches customs or transport regulations
- Live animals (including pets and livestock)
- Opened food, perishable goods or items requiring refrigeration during transit
- High-value jewellery, cash, important personal documents
- Industrial machinery beyond domestic/office scale
If you are unsure about a particular item, we will advise during the quotation stage.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a man with van in Waterloo cost?
Pricing depends on distance, volume of goods, access and the number of porters required. For many local moves we use an hourly rate, with a minimum booking period, while more defined jobs are quoted at a fixed price. Your quote will specify exactly what is included – travel time, loading and unloading, any congestion or ULEZ charges, and whether packing materials are provided. The best way to get an accurate figure is to share a simple inventory and your addresses so we can tailor the price to your move.
